Transaction 96804ebbb2e7221bd70a265ee7ac3def0b1c19c156a781a1980e9958dbc5eb4f
1 Input
1 Output
-
96804ebbb2e7221bd70a265ee7ac3def0b1c19c156a781a1980e9958dbc5eb4f:0
- value
- 22620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 747c4fc5ef73836d1348e4bd4990ee273c2bade6 OP_EQUAL
- address
- 3CJwE7phsjK2DxsLqAcSmsEC9fuMeTV2Di